Bonuses – What to Watch

International casinos tend to offer larger promotions than their UK-regulated counterparts. Welcome bonuses, no deposit offers, free spins, reload bonuses, cashback and loyalty programmes are all common. But the conditions matter more than the headline number.

Bonus Type Common Terms to Check
Welcome Bonus Wagering requirements, eligible games, expiry period
No Deposit Bonus Withdrawal limits, wagering requirements, game restrictions
Free Spins Eligible slots, wagering on winnings, max cashout
Cashback Percentage returned, qualifying losses, time limits

Always read the terms before you claim. A generous bonus with 50x wagering and a seven-day expiry is a different proposition from one with 30x and 30 days.

What to Check Before You Sign Up

Because these casinos aren’t covered by UK regulation, the responsibility shifts to you. Here’s what matters most when choosing where to play.

  1. Verify the licence – check it’s active and issued by a recognised offshore regulator
  2. Research the operator – look for real player feedback, not just the site’s own claims
  3. Review bonus terms – understand wagering, expiry, game eligibility and max withdrawal limits
  4. Check payment methods – make sure your preferred deposit and withdrawal options are supported
  5. Test customer support – reach out to live chat or email before you deposit

New operators have a shorter track record, so there’s less information available about withdrawal reliability and overall experience. That doesn’t mean they’re unsafe – it means you need to verify rather than assume.
